Alaska Fishing License

License Cost
Resident$29
Non-Resident$145
Requirements

Required for ages 16+. King salmon stamp required additionally.

Species Regulations

Pacific Cod
Season:Year-round
Bag Limit:No limit
Size Limit:No size limit

Check specific area regulations for closures or gear restrictions. Regulations may vary by area and time of year.

Lingcod
Season:Varies by area
Bag Limit:Varies by area
Size Limit:Varies by area

Lingcod regulations are complex and vary widely by location. Consult the ADF&G sport fishing regulations for the specific area.

Rockfish
Season:Varies by area and species
Bag Limit:Varies by area and species
Size Limit:Varies by area and species

Rockfish regulations are complex and vary greatly by management area and species. Retention of some rockfish species may be prohibited in certain areas.

Steelhead
Season:Varies by location and time of year
Bag Limit:Varies by location
Size Limit:Varies by location

Steelhead regulations are highly variable and often include seasonal closures and specific gear restrictions. Check the specific regulations for the area you plan to fish.
